How to Choose the Right Restaurant Name with Ideas & Examples
Let us explore how to grow your restaurant franchise business by choosing the right restaurant name. Your restaurant’s name is more than just a label; it’s a crucial part of your brand identity. A well-chosen name can attract customers, convey your concept, and set you apart from the competition. We’ll delve into the art of selecting the perfect restaurant name, complete with ideas and examples to inspire you.
Captivating and Memorable:
The first step in choosing a restaurant name is to make it captivating and easy to remember. Think about names like “Café du Monde” or “Starbucks.” These names stick in your mind. Aim for a name that’s unique, catchy, and stands out. For instance, “Spice N Rice” has a nice ring to it and evokes the essence of an Indian restaurant.
Reflect Your Cuisine:
Your restaurant’s name should give customers a hint about the type of cuisine you serve. For example, “Tandoori Palace” clearly indicates an Indian restaurant specializing in tandoori dishes. Make sure your name aligns with your menu.
Keep it Simple:
Simplicity is key. A simple name is easier to remember, and spell, and easy to search in any search engine or social media. Long, complex names can be a mouthful. For example, “Biryani Bliss” over “Bay Leaf Modern Indian Cuisine”.
Local Appeal:
Consider local elements when choosing a name. Mentioning your city, town, or a local landmark can make your restaurant feel more relatable to the community. “Bangalore Benne House” is a great example.
Avoid Generic Terms:
Steer clear of generic terms like “restaurant” or “hotel” in your name. They don’t add any character and can make it hard for your establishment to stand out. Instead of “Indian Restaurant,” try something like “Punjabi Dhaba.”
Check for Trademarks:
Before finalizing your name, do a thorough check for trademarks. You don’t want to run into legal issues down the road. A unique name is essential for brand protection.
Test it Out:
Run the name by family, friends, and potential customers. Get their feedback and see how they react to it. A name that resonates with people is more likely to succeed.
Examples for Inspiration:
“Chaat Mahal”: A name that’s simple, memorable, and hints at Indian street food.
“Taste of Chennai”: Reflects the Tamil Nadu cuisine.
“Masala Fusion Grill”: Combines traditional Indian Flavors with a modern twist.
“Flavours of Punjab”: A name that brings the essence of Punjab to mind.
“South Indian Creations”: Simple and straightforward, perfect for a menu full of South Indian dishes like Idli, Dosa, Filter Coffee and so on.
